Understanding Changing Throw Out Bearing

Throw out bearing, also known as a release bearing, is an integral part of the clutch system. Its primary function is to disengage the clutch by applying pressure to the clutch fingers when the clutch pedal is depressed. When the throw out bearing fails, it can lead to a range of symptoms, including grinding noises, difficulty shifting gears, and clutch slipping.

Symptoms of a Failing Throw Out Bearing:

Symptom Cause
Grinding noises during clutch engagement Worn or damaged bearing surface
Difficulty shifting gears Reduced pressure on clutch fingers
Clutch slipping Insufficient release of clutch
Vibration or chattering during clutch operation Bearing misalignment or damage

Changing Throw Out Bearing: Step-by-Step Approach

  1. Safety First: Park the vehicle on a level surface, engage the parking brake, and disconnect the negative battery terminal.

  2. Gather Tools and Materials: Collect the necessary tools such as wrenches, sockets, screwdrivers, and a new throw out bearing.

  3. Remove Transmission: Support the transmission with a jack and remove the bolts holding it in place. Carefully lower the transmission.

  4. Locate Throw Out Bearing: Inspect the clutch assembly and locate the throw out bearing. It is typically attached to a fork or pivot arm.

  5. Remove Throw Out Bearing: Disconnect the bearing from the fork or pivot arm and remove it from the housing.

  6. Install New Bearing: Lubricate the new bearing and insert it into the housing. Connect it to the fork or pivot arm.

  7. Reassemble Transmission: Reinstall the transmission and tighten the bolts to the specified torque.

  8. Connect Battery: Reconnect the negative battery terminal and start the vehicle. Test the clutch operation to ensure proper function.

Challenges and Limitations

Changing a throw out bearing can be a challenging task, especially for inexperienced mechanics. Some common limitations include:

  • Access Difficulties: The location of the throw out bearing can be difficult to reach, requiring specialized tools or lifting equipment.
  • Limited Space: The cramped engine compartment can make it challenging to maneuver and manipulate tools effectively.
  • Special Tools: Certain vehicle models may require specialized tools, such as clutch alignment tools, to ensure proper installation.

Common Mistakes to Avoid

  1. Skipping Safety Precautions: Neglecting to disconnect the battery or secure the vehicle can lead to accidents or injuries.

  2. Using Incorrect Tools: Employing improper tools can damage the throw out bearing or other components during the replacement process.

  3. Forgetting to Lubricate: Omitting lubrication can lead to premature wear and failure of the new bearing.

  4. Ignoring Other Clutch Issues: Failing to address other potential clutch problems, such as worn clutch discs or a faulty pressure plate, can result in reduced clutch performance.

  5. Overtightening Bolts: Excessively tightening the bolts that secure the transmission can damage the housing or bolts.
